gpt4 book ai didi

Python Pandas 'ffill' 方法不起作用

转载 作者:行者123 更新时间:2023-11-28 16:24:00 25 4
gpt4 key购买 nike

在“用于数据分析的 Python”一书中,有一个使用 pandas 的 Series 数据结构进行重新索引的示例。我将这个简单的代码复制到 iPython 笔记本中并运行它,但它没有改变 obj3

obj3 = Series(['blue', 'purple', 'yellow'], index=[0, 2, 4])
print(obj3)
obj3.reindex(range(6), method='ffill')
print(obj3)

书中说输出应该是:

Out[85]:
0 blue
1 blue
2 purple
3 purple
4 yellow
5 yellow

尝试了一种名为“pad”的不同(假设等效)方法但没有成功。为什么这不起作用?

最佳答案

你需要分配 obj3 =:

obj3 = obj3.reindex(range(6), method='ffill')
print(obj3)
0 blue
1 blue
2 purple
3 purple
4 yellow
5 yellow
dtype: object

关于Python Pandas 'ffill' 方法不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38095605/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com